Sesame Noodle Salad

A zesty and flavorful summer salad recipe perfect for a quick 15-minute meal.

Prep Time15 min
Cook Time15 min
Servings4
DifficultyEasy

Ingredients

  • 8 oz dried soba noodles
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 2 tbsp sesame oil
  • 1 tbsp rice vinegar
  • 1 tbsp honey
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tsp grated ginger
  • 1 tsp chili-garlic sauce
  • 1/2 English cucumber, julienned
  • 1 red bell pepper, julienned
  • 2 green onions, sliced
  • 2 tbsp roasted peanuts, chopped
  • 2 tbsp toasted sesame seeds

Instructions

  1. Cook the soba noodles according to package instructions, then rinse under cold water and drain well.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together soy sauce, sesame oil, rice vinegar, hon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, and chili-garlic sauce to create the dressing.
  3. Add the cooked noodles, julienned cucumber, julienned red bell pepper, and sliced green onions to the bowl with the dressing.
  4. Toss everything together until the noodles are evenly coated with the dressing.
  5. Garnish with chopped roasted peanuts and toasted sesame seeds before serving.
